About Out of the Darkness (1978) — A Political Thriller Where Bravery Meets Betrayal
Set against the grim backdrop of fascist-occupied Albania, *Out of the Darkness* (1978) follows Petrit, a humble cleaner at the Ministry of Internal Affairs who uncovers a web of dangerous secrets. As he navigates the oppressive atmosphere of the regime, Petrit secretly aids the resistance by passing along critical intelligence, risking everything for a cause he believes in. Directed by Kristaq Dhamo, this intense political thriller blends suspense with raw human drama, exposing the moral dilemmas of ordinary people thrust into extraordinary circumstances.
With a steady pulse of tension and a stark, unflinching tone, the film explores themes of courage, betrayal, and the quiet heroism found in the shadows of tyranny. The atmosphere is heavy with paranoia, where every whispered conversation could be a trap, and trust is a luxury few can afford. Starring Krenar Arifi as Petrit, along with standout performances from Perika Gjezi and Ndrek Luca, *Out of the Darkness* delivers a gripping narrative that lingers long after the final scene.
